Banana Corn Fritters

Prep Time 2 minutes
Cook Time 6 minutes
Total Time 10 minutes

Ingredients  

  • 3/4 cup cornmeal
  • 1/2 cup fl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 3 medium bananas
  • 2 tablespoons milk
  • 1 egg
  • 1 ear of corn, kernels cut off the cob (or 1/2 cup frozen corn, defrosted)
  • vegetable or canola oil, as needed
  • honey, for serving

Instructions 

  • Combine the first 5 ingredients in a bowl and whisk to combine.
  • In a separate bowl, mash the bananas and add the milk and egg. Whisk to combine.
  • Add the cornmeal mixture to the wet ingredients with the corn kernels and whisk until smooth.
  • Place about 1 tbsp of oil in a large sautepan over medium heat.
  • Place 2 tbsp of the banana/corn mixture in the pan to make each fritter.
  • Cook the fritters for 3 minutes on each side until golden and cooked through.
  • Drizzle with honey and serve.
  • *Allow to cool then place in ziploc bags, label and freeze up to 4 months. When ready, place in toaster oven or oven at 300 for 10 minutes until heated through.
